Soft: During the earlier part of pregnancy the cervix feels like the tip of your nose but softer and more compressible. In labor, the cervix becomes less long - eventually becoming almost flush with the vaginal wall. . Additionally the cervix opens to facilitate the passage of the fetus from the uterus to the vaginal canal. Don't check your own cervix during pregnancy.
